I think the OP referred to the ICE raids in the northern cities. I have no idea about the veracity of these claims, but I've heard a lot of American left-wingers say that the ICE does not follow the expected police protocol: when the police arrest someone, they first have a reasonable suspicion that this specific person has committed a specific crime, they perform the arrest and read the suspect their rights. Instead, ICE raiders perform broad racial profiling ("look, a group of brown people not speaking English to each other and hanging around the Home Depot parking lot!"), indiscriminately detain anyone who matches this profile and then make them prove they are not illegal aliens.
